This program is tailored for individuals aiming to achieve Chartered status with the Royal Institution of Chartered Surveyors. The curriculum provides adaptable study options, allowing you to balance learning with personal and work responsibilities. It aligns with industry demands, equipping you with the expertise to excel as a professional surveyor in construction.

You'll pursue the RICS-recognized pathway for Quantity Surveyors. The rigorous academic content fosters critical thinking, independent analysis, and ethical decision-making relevant to both workplace scenarios and professional standards. Additionally, you'll gain versatile skills including research, troubleshooting, data interpretation, information handling, sustainable practices, and clear communication.

Qualification Requirements

We normally require an honours degree of 2:2 or above in Quantity Surveying, Construction Management, or a closely related subject.
You also need two years' professional experience in Construction, which you should outline in your application.

IELTS- Overall score of 6.5 with 5.5 in each component
TOEFL iBT - Overall score of 90 or above, including a minimum of 17 in Listening and Writing, 18 in Reading and 20 in Speaking.
